About Schools in Pinehurst, Georgia

Pinehurst, Georgia is home to 3 schools, including 2 public schools and 1 private school. The city's schools span 1 elementary school, 1 middle school.

With an average rating of 5.7 out of 10, schools in Pinehurst show moderate performance on the MySchoolScout composite scale, which measures academic achievement, student growth, equity, and school environment.

The highest-performing school in Pinehurst is Fullington Academy with a composite score of 6.2/10, demonstrating strong academic outcomes and school quality metrics.

Pinehurst is served by 1 school district: Dooly County. These districts collectively serve 1,113 students.

Pinehurst's community shows 11% bachelor's degree attainment with a median household income of $50,217. The poverty rate in the area is 21.6%.

Community Profile

Pinehurst has a median household income of $50,217. It is a community where 11%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$92,500, with a median rent of $734/month. The area has a poverty rate of 21.6%, indicating some economic challenges in the community.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.

How We Rate Schools

Every school receives a composite score from 1 to 10 based on four pillars: Academic Performance (50%), Student Growth (20%), Equity (15%), and Learning Environment (15%). Scores are built from publicly available data including standardized test results, enrollment figures, and school climate indicators.
